Smallest.ai raised $13 million in Series A funding led by Seligman Ventures, with Sierra Ventures and 3one4 Capital participating, bringing total funding to over $21 million. The startup debuted Hydra, an asynchronous speech-to-speech model built on its Voice 4.0 architecture for real-time, human-like conversations.
